    Iran Courage: Farnoush Hamidian

    The conversation begins with an introduction and the Farnoush's background, followed by a discussion on Farnoush's childhood, ambitions, and memories of growing up in Iran. The conversation then shifts to a discussion on James Bond films, early memories, and family influence. This leads to a deeper exploration of Farnoush's experiences growing up in Iran, the cultural influences, education, indoctrination, oppression, rebellion, and the societal pressures she faced during her youth. The conversation covers Farnoush's childhood in Iran, the challenges and oppression she faced, the trauma and resilience she exhibited, her journey into modelling and empowerment, and the discussion on Persian women and identity. The conversation covers the domino effect of protests, the significance of the Berlin Wall moment for Iran, the role of the Iranian Royal family in the movement, the future of Iran, and the importance of advocacy and awareness.     Canada's Crossroads Dimpee Brar

    The conversation covers a wide range of topics, including Canadian politics, conservatism, geopolitics with Iran, and the influence of foreign powers in Canada. It also delves into the shift in political ideologies among younger generations and the role of feminism in different cultural contexts. The discussion highlights the challenges faced by Canadian Iranians and the impact of foreign interference on Canadian soil. The conversation delves into the threat of foreign actors and organizations to Canadian sovereignty, the impact of foreign influence on domestic governance, and the need for unity and action to protect the nation. It also explores concerns about the erosion of freedom of speech and press, the potential impact of economic and security threats, and the need for political engagement and activism to safeguard Western civilization in Canada.     Canada's Rebound Chance

    The conversation covers a range of topics including Canadian politics, Cold War history, and the personal background of the guest. It delves into the guest's entry into politics, the impact of international events, the Unite the Right movement, and the challenges faced during the financial crisis. The discussion also explores the guest's role in economic development and the pivotal moments in Canadian politics. The conversation covers a range of topics, including political decision-making, the auto bailout, balancing the budget, personal finance, Canada's role in global industry and defense, the 2011 election, political strategy, and the future of Canadian conservatism. The core takeaways include the adaptation of conservative politics to the issues of the day, the importance of varied life experiences in politics, and the core elements of conservatism: freedom, limited but effective government, and compassion for people.
